Eden is a workplace management platform designed for small to midsize businesses. It offers a suite of tools including desk booking, room scheduling, visitor management, and more. Eden helps businesses optimize their office space, streamline daily operations, and improve the employee experience. Its user-friendly interface and integrations with popular communication tools make it a convenient solution for managing the modern workplace.

Pros of Eden
User-friendly interface and easy to navigate.
Excellent customer support, responsive and helpful.
Integrates with Slack and other communication tools.
Helps manage desk booking and office space efficiently.
Useful for tracking office usage and attendance.
Provides valuable data for office space decisions.
Effective for managing visitors and health checks.
Easy to implement and deploy.
Continuously improving with new features and updates.
Advanced reporting features require downloading a file.
Too many clicks to process some functions.
Slack integration has some glitches/bugs.
Difficult to book recurring desks.
Some features like Marketplace are not available in all regions like UK.

How much does Eden cost?
How much does Eden cost?
Eden's pricing varies by product. Desk booking starts at $2.25 per desk/month, room scheduling at $15 per room/month, visitor management at $89 per location/month, delivery management at $149 per location/month, and internal ticketing at $49 per agent/month.
